Macey bought a carton of 18 Dr. Peppers for $2.30. At this rate, what would be the approximate cost per soda?

Mathematics
1 answer:
Ghella [55]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

.13 cents per can

Step-by-step explanation:

If you bought 18 cans with $2.30, you need to divide 2.30 by 18 becauseyou need to find out the unit price for each can.  When you divide .2.30 by 18 you get .1277777repeaing so you can just round up from there and get .13 cents.
